Application-Level Encryption: The process of encrypting sensitive data within the application layer to protect its confidentiality and integrity. This type of encryption ensures that only authorized users or systems can access the data by securing it at the point of creation and continuing through storage or transmission. Examples include encrypting passwords before storing them in a database, securing credit card information during transaction processing, or encrypting files before sending them over the Internet. While this process strengthens data protection, it primarily addresses confidentiality and integrity, not availability, which relates more to system reliability and access control mechanisms.
Categories: CC D5: Security Operations | CCSP D2: Cloud Data Security | CISM D3: Information Security Program | CISSP D8: Software Development Security | Security+ D1: General Security Concepts | SSCP D5: Cryptography
« Back to Glossary Index